Πώς να δημιουργήσετε συντομεύσεις μενού εφαρμογών στο Linux

click fraud protection

Οι χρήστες ξεκινούν προγράμματα στο Linux με "launchers". Αυτά τα αρχεία περιέχουν συγκεκριμένες οδηγίες για το πώς πρέπει να εκτελεί το πρόγραμμα το λειτουργικό σύστημα Linux και πώς θα πρέπει να εμφανίζεται το εικονίδιο, μεταξύ άλλων. Στο Linux, εάν θέλετε να δημιουργήσετε συντομεύσεις μενού εφαρμογών, θα διαπιστώσετε ότι είναι λίγο πιο δύσκολο, σε σύγκριση με Mac ή Windows, καθώς οι χρήστες δεν μπορούν απλώς να κάνουν δεξί κλικ σε ένα πρόγραμμα και να επιλέξουν τη "δημιουργία συντόμευσης" επιλογή. Αντ 'αυτού, εάν θέλετε να δημιουργήσετε συντομεύσεις μενού εφαρμογών στην επιφάνεια εργασίας Linux, πρόκειται για μια εμπλεκόμενη διαδικασία που απαιτεί λίγη τεχνογνωσία.

ΕΙΔΟΠΟΙΗΣΗ SPOILER: Μετακινηθείτε προς τα κάτω και παρακολουθήστε το εκπαιδευτικό βίντεο στο τέλος αυτού του άρθρου.

Συντομεύσεις μενού εφαρμογών - Terminal

Ίσως ο γρηγορότερος τρόπος για να δημιουργήσετε συντομεύσεις μενού εφαρμογών στην επιφάνεια εργασίας Linux είναι να δημιουργήσετε μία στο τερματικό. Η μετάβαση στην τερματική διαδρομή είναι λιγότερο φιλική προς το χρήστη, καθώς δεν υπάρχει ένας καλός επεξεργαστής GUI για την εκχώρηση κατηγοριών εφαρμογών και χωρίς επιλογέα εικονιδίων κ.λπ.

instagram viewer

Το πρώτο βήμα για τη δημιουργία μιας νέας συντόμευσης εφαρμογής στο Linux είναι να δημιουργήσετε ένα κενό αρχείο Desktop. Στο τερματικό, χρησιμοποιήστε το αφή εντολή για να δημιουργήσετε μια νέα συντόμευση.

αγγίξτε ~ / Desktop / example.desktop. chmod + x ~ / Desktop / example.desktop. echo '[Desktop Entry]' >> ~ / Desktop / example.desktop

Το νέο εικονίδιο συντόμευσης βρίσκεται στην επιφάνεια εργασίας, αλλά δεν έχει οδηγίες προγράμματος. Ας το επιδιορθώσουμε με την επεξεργασία του νέου αρχείου στο πρόγραμμα επεξεργασίας κειμένου Nano.

nano ~ / Desktop / example.desktop

Η πρώτη γραμμή για οποιαδήποτε συντόμευση εφαρμογής είναι "Όνομα". Αυτή η γραμμή θα δώσει στη συντόμευση της εφαρμογής το όνομά της στα μενού. Στο πρόγραμμα επεξεργασίας κειμένου Nano, δώστε ένα όνομα στη συντόμευσή σας.

Όνομα = Παράδειγμα συντόμευσης

Μετά το "Όνομα", η επόμενη γραμμή στη συντόμευση για προσθήκη είναι "Σχόλιο". Αυτή η γραμμή είναι προαιρετική αλλά πολύ χρήσιμη καθώς επιτρέπει στο μενού να εμφανίζει ορισμένες πληροφορίες σχετικά με τη συντόμευση.

Σχόλιο = Αυτό είναι ένα παράδειγμα εκκίνησης

Με τα "Όνομα" και "Σχόλιο" εκτός δρόμου, μπορούμε να φτάσουμε στο πραγματικό κρέας του εκτοξευτή. Στο πρόγραμμα επεξεργασίας κειμένου Nano, προσθέστε τη γραμμή "Exec".

Η γραμμή "Exec" λέει στο λειτουργικό σας Linux πού βρίσκεται το πρόγραμμα και πώς πρέπει να ξεκινήσει.

Exec = ορίσματα εντολών

Το Exec είναι πολύ ευέλικτο και μπορεί να ξεκινήσει το Python, το Bash και οτιδήποτε άλλο μπορείτε να σκεφτείτε. Για παράδειγμα, για να εκτελέσετε ένα κέλυφος ή bash script μέσω της συντόμευσης, κάντε:

Exec = sh /path/to/sh/script.sh

Εναλλακτικά, ορίστε τη συντόμευση της εφαρμογής σας για να εκτελέσετε ένα πρόγραμμα Python με:

Exec = python / path / to / python / app

Μόλις η γραμμή "Exec" ρυθμιστεί σύμφωνα με τις προτιμήσεις σας, προσθέστε τη γραμμή "Type".

Τύπος = Εφαρμογή

Πρέπει να ρυθμίσετε την προσαρμοσμένη συντόμευσή σας με ένα εικονίδιο; Χρησιμοποιήστε τη γραμμή "Εικονίδιο".

Εικονίδιο = / διαδρομή / προς / προσαρμοσμένο / εικονίδιο

Τώρα που έχουν οριστεί το Όνομα, το Σχόλιο, το Exec και το εικονίδιο, είναι ασφαλές να αποθηκεύσετε την προσαρμοσμένη συντόμευση. Χρησιμοποιώντας την Ctrl + O συνδυασμός πληκτρολογίου, αποθηκεύστε τη συντόμευση της εφαρμογής. Στη συνέχεια, βγείτε από το Νάνο με Ctrl + X.

Εγκαταστήστε την προσαρμοσμένη συντόμευση εφαρμογής σε όλο το σύστημα με:

sudo mv ~ / Desktop / example.desktop / usr / share / εφαρμογές

Συντομεύσεις μενού εφαρμογών - Alacarte

Υπάρχουν πολλοί συντάκτες μενού στο Linux. Ως επί το πλείστον, όλοι λειτουργούν παρόμοια και κάνουν το ίδιο πράγμα. Για καλύτερα αποτελέσματα, σας προτείνουμε να χρησιμοποιήσετε την εφαρμογή Alacarte. Είναι εύκολο στη χρήση, λειτουργεί σε όλα και μπορεί να εγκατασταθεί ακόμη και στις πιο σκοτεινές διανομές Linux (λόγω της σχέσης του με το έργο Gnome).

Το Alacarte ενδέχεται να είναι ήδη εγκατεστημένο στον υπολογιστή σας Linux. Ελέγξτε και δείτε πατώντας Alt + F2, πληκτρολογώντας "alacarte" και κάνοντας κλικ στο enter. Εάν ξεκινήσει η εφαρμογή, το έχετε ήδη εγκαταστήσει. Εάν δεν συμβεί τίποτα, θα πρέπει να το εγκαταστήσετε. Ακολουθήστε τις παρακάτω οδηγίες για να λειτουργήσει.

Ubuntu

sudo apt εγκατάσταση alacarte

Ντέμπιαν

sudo apt-get εγκατάσταση του alacarte

Arch Linux

sudo pacman -S alacarte

Μαλακό καπέλλο

sudo dnf εγκαταστήστε το alacarte -y

OpenSUSE

sudo zypper εγκαταστήστε το alacarte

Γενικό Linux

Δεν μπορείτε να βρείτε την εφαρμογή επεξεργασίας μενού Alacarte στη διανομή Linux; Επισκεφθείτε τον ιστότοπο κώδικα souce και χτίστε το μόνοι σας!

Κάντε συντομεύσεις

Η πραγματοποίηση συντομεύσεων με το πρόγραμμα επεξεργασίας μενού Alacarte είναι απλή. Για να ξεκινήσετε, κάντε κλικ σε μια κατηγορία. Σε αυτό το παράδειγμα, θα κάνουμε μια νέα συντόμευση στην κατηγορία "Διαδίκτυο".

Στην κατηγορία "Διαδίκτυο", κάντε κλικ στο κουμπί "Νέο στοιχείο". Με την επιλογή "Νέο στοιχείο" θα ανοίξει το "Launcher Properties".

Στα παράθυρα "Launcher Properties", υπάρχουν μερικά πράγματα που πρέπει να συμπληρώσετε. Το πρώτο πράγμα που πρέπει να συμπληρώσετε είναι το "Όνομα". Γράψτε στο όνομα του εκκινητή στην ενότητα "Όνομα". Στη συνέχεια, προχωρήστε στο "Command".

Η ενότητα "Εντολή" είναι όπου ο χρήστης καθορίζει τι θα κάνει η συντόμευση. Κάντε κλικ στο κουμπί «περιήγηση» για να αναζητήσετε ένα σενάριο κελύφους, δυαδικό, εφαρμογή python κ.λπ. και φορτώστε το. Εναλλακτικά, γράψτε σε μια εντολή, όπως ένα από τα ακόλουθα:

python /path/to/python/app.py

ή

sh /path/to/shell/script/app.sh

ή

κρασί / path / to/wine/app.exe

Όταν έχει ρυθμιστεί η ενότητα "Εντολή" του εκκινητή, γράψτε ένα σχόλιο στην ενότητα "Σχόλιο" και, στη συνέχεια, επιλέξτε "OK" για να ολοκληρώσετε. Αφού κάνετε κλικ στο κουμπί "OK", η Alacarte θα αποθηκεύσει αμέσως και θα ενεργοποιήσει τη νέα συντόμευση της εφαρμογής σας στην επιφάνεια εργασίας Linux!

watch instagram story